Output ed7b3db3fbf0275269d41216f11de9c1b38029d91e2d9a58f8161af230c4619a:55

value
65217597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5480d58dd444ad5491d6ac7e481e68284071f00d OP_EQUAL
address
MFbyL6oFAq8QFruGrrUj1V9v3ZxBrti7zf
transaction
ed7b3db3fbf0275269d41216f11de9c1b38029d91e2d9a58f8161af230c4619a
spent
true